Методы сбора требований

Интервью 👥

При работе с требованиями системные аналитики используют разные подходы, чтобы лучше понять потребности бизнеса и пользователей. Один из методов — провести интервью.

📌 Что за метод?

Интервью — это личное общение с заказчиком, пользователями или другими людьми, где аналитик задаёт вопросы, чтобы получить полное представление о проекте.

📌 Что спрашивать?

Главное — выяснить, какие задачи должен решать продукт, как он будет использоваться, какие есть ограничения и ожидания. Стоит задавать открытые вопросы, которые помогают раскрыть потребности и проблемы пользователей.

📌 Как учиться проводить интервью?

Начните с простых вопросов и постепенно углубляйтесь. Важно развивать навыки активного слушания, чтобы понять не только ответы, но и контекст. Практика — лучший способ научиться задавать вопросы!

Подробно про данный метод мы рассказали в статье “Методы сбора требований - Проводим интервью”. Там вы прочитаете о том, как готовиться к интервью, какие вопросы задавать, и что делать после него.

Семинар 💼

Если нужно собрать несколько заинтересованных сторон на одной встрече и услышать мнение каждого, то лучше организовать семинар.

📌 Семинар — это организованная встреча, где заказчики, пользователи и команда разработки совместно обсуждают требования к продукту. Обычно цель такой встречи — достичь консенсуса по спорным вопросам.

Как проходит?

1️⃣ Определяется цель семинара. Например, решить, какие основные функции нужны в приложении.

2️⃣ Приглашаются все заинтересованные стороны.

3️⃣ Работа модератора. Кто-то из команды (обычно аналитик) ведёт встречу, задаёт вопросы и фиксирует идеи. Также модератор решает конфликты на встрече 😈

4️⃣ Результаты. После обсуждения вы получаете список согласованных требований и задач.

Плюсы:

✅ Быстрое согласование требований с несколькими сторонами.

✅ Возможность учесть разные мнения на месте.

Минусы:

❌ Требует тщательной подготовки и модерации.

❌ Может быть сложно достичь единого мнения, если участники имеют разные цели.

Фокус-группа 💡

Если вам нужно глубже понять мнение пользователей или проверить гипотезы, организуйте фокус-группу.

📌 Фокус-группа — это встреча, где собираются представители целевой аудитории, чтобы обсудить продукт, функции или проблемы. В отличие от семинара, здесь акцент на пользователей, а не на команде заказчика.

Как проходит?

1️⃣ Определяется цель. Например, узнать, насколько удобен интерфейс приложения.

2️⃣ Приглашаются представители целевой аудитории, обычно 5-10 человек.

3️⃣ Модератор направляет беседу, задаёт вопросы и следит за активностью участников.

4️⃣ Участники делятся своими впечатлениями, обсуждают предложенные решения.

Плюсы:

✅ Глубокое понимание потребностей пользователей.

✅ Возможность протестировать гипотезы или интерфейсы.

Минусы:

❌ Требует подготовки и ресурсов.

❌ Мнения участников могут быть субъективными и не отражать потребности всей аудитории.

Фокус-группы помогают услышать реальных пользователей и адаптировать продукт под их нужды. 🎯

Методы сбора требований без общения: Анализ аналогов 🔍

Сбор требований — это не только интервью, семинары или фокус-группы. Иногда полезно обратиться к методам, которые не предполагают общения. Но важно помнить, что такие методы работают в связке с другими: одно без другого редко бывает эффективным. 🧩

📌 Анализ аналогов

Этот метод предполагает изучение существующих решений на рынке. Например, если вам нужно разработать интернет-магазин, вы можете посмотреть, как это реализовано в Wildberries и Ozon.

Что анализируем?

1️⃣ Какие функции есть в аналогах?

2️⃣ Как всё выглядит, что удобно, а что нет?

3️⃣ Какие технологии используются?

Плюсы:

✅ Даёт идеи для реализации.

✅ Позволяет увидеть лучшие практики.

✅ Помогает понять, что уже есть на рынке, чтобы не изобретать велосипед.

Минусы:

❌ Не даёт информации о специфике бизнеса заказчика.

❌ Не всегда показывает, что именно нужно вашему клиенту.

Анализ документов 📜

Вы посмотрели другие системы и немного вдохновились на разработку! Теперь пора изучить документы, которые уже есть по проекту.

Вы же не подумали, что до вашего прихода на проект вообще ничего нет? 😉

Конечно, кто-то до вас уже проработал концепцию, и у заказчика наверняка есть видение по решению его проблем. Соберите всё, что есть по проекту: схемы бизнес-процессов, руководство пользователя, скриншоты, старые презентации. Также в компаниях ведут базу знаний, например, в Confluence. Вы можете самостоятельно поискать информацию там.

А бывает и так, что документации вообще нет 😱

Выбивайте хоть что-то: скриншоты аналогичных систем, идей, в конце концов вместе сядьте и нарисуйте видение будущей системы.

Итак, плюсы метода:

✅ Документы могут содержать детали, которые не всплыли в разговоре.

✅ Помогают понять историю проекта и предыдущие решения.

Минусы:

❌ Документы устаревают.

❌ Не все компании ведут документацию детально, а иногда её просто нет.

Наблюдение 👀

Хотите понять, как пользователи работают с системой на самом деле? Наблюдение помогает увидеть реальный процесс и выявить скрытые проблемы.

🔍 Как это выглядит?

Вы правда приходите на рабочие места пользователей и смотрите, как они работают.

  • Например, изучаете производственные процессы на заводе.
  • Приглашаете пользователей в ваш офис, чтобы посмотреть лично за их действиями, как они используют продукт.
  • Организуете встречи в Zoom, чтобы посмотреть удалённо за процессом.

Плюсы метода:

✅ Видите реальную работу пользователей и скрытые проблемы.

✅ Выявляете нюансы, которые сложно описать словами (их можно только увидеть).

Минусы:

❌ Требует времени.

❌ Не заменяет общения — нужно уточнять детали с пользователями.

Наблюдение — мощное дополнение к другим методам сбора требований. Комбинируйте и получите максимально точные данные!

Анкетирование 📋

Анкетирование - это удобный и экономичный способ узнать, чего хотят большие группы пользователей. Вы просто создаете опрос и отправляете его нужным людям. Этот метод особенно хорош, когда участники распределены по разным местам, потому что анкеты можно заполнить онлайн.

Результаты анкет можно использовать как стартовую точку для других методов сбора требований. Например, после опроса можно выявить ключевые проблемы, чтобы потом их обсудить на семинаре с лицами, принимающими решения.

avatar

Вера Коновалова

Старший системный аналитик с более 8 лет опыта. За плечами более 15 проектов. Примеры: агрегатор покупки ОСАГО, судебная система, Т-Инвестиции, система для управления рисками в Райффайзен Банке, проекты для Сбера, личный кабинет Лаборатории Касперского. Основатель AnalystCore.

Подписаться

Читайте авторские заметки в нашем сообществе

Telegram для начинающих

Перейти в → AnalystCore | Начало пути в IT | Системный аналитик

Приходите за теорией простыми словами и мотивацией!

Telegram для опытных

Перейти в → AnalystCore | Системный аналитик в IT

Сюда за лайфхаками по работе